Summary:The results of chromatographic study of psychoactive drugs emerged in recent years on the illicit market are rendered in the article. 18 phenethylamine derivatives were identified by means of gas-liquid chromatography with mass selective detection and their chromatographic retention indexes were defined. The known regularities of fragmentation of molecules of saturated aliphatic amines in electron impact ionization were confirmed during the study of the mass spectra of the known phenethylamine derivatives and used to decrypt the mass spectra of 3,4-methylenedioxy-N-methcathinone, 4-methylmethcathinones and 4-methylethcathinones. The indicators of chromatographic retention in the solvent system of chloroform-acetone-ethanol-25% ammonia solution (20:20:3:1) were identified by thin layer chromatography on silica gel for these compounds.Key words: psychoactive substance, phenethylamine derivatives, identification, chromatography, mass spectrometry, fragmentation.(Russian)DOI: http://dx.doi.org/10.15826/analitika.2014.18.2.007 S.V.
